Research - Nanoscience/Materials and Biomolecular Simulations

Large scale simulations of real materials, bio-molecular processes, semiconductors, nanotubes and related nanoscale structures; quantum Monte Carlo simulations; O N and multiscale methods; quantum transport; nanostructured materials; phase separation; ferrofluids liquid-state theory; interfaces; diffusion; neural networks; pattern formation; electronic properties of transition-metal oxides and silicates.
